Prep Time: 30 Minutes Cook Time: 0 Minutes |
Ready In: 30 Minutes Servings: 81 |
|
With its pretty butterscotch and chocolate layers, this creamy fudge looks fancy. Suggests Jackie Hannahs of Fountain, Michigan. It makes a great holiday gift. Both my husband and my dad love trying different kinds of fudge. They give this recipe a big thumbs-up! Ingredients:
1-1/2 teaspoons plus 1/2 cup butter, softened, divided |
2 cups packed brown sugar |
1 cup sugar |
1 cup evaporated milk |
1 jar (7 ounces) marshmallow creme |
1 teaspoon vanilla extract |
1-1/2 cups semisweet chocolate chips |
1 cup chopped walnuts |
1/2 cup butterscotch chips |
Directions:
1. Line a 9-in. square pan with foil and grease the foil with 1-1/2 teaspoons butter; set aside. In a large heavy saucepan, combine the sugars, milk and remaining butter. Cook and stir over medium heat until sugar is dissolved. Bring to a rapid boil; boil for 5 minutes, stirring constantly. Reduce heat to low; stir in the marshmallow creme until melted and blended. 2. Remove from the heat; stir in vanilla. Pour 2-1/2 cups into a large bowl; stir in chocolate chips and walnuts until chips are melted. Pour into prepared pan. 3. Add the butterscotch chips to the remaining marshmallow mixture; stir until chips are melted. Pour over the chocolate layer and gently spread to cover. Refrigerate overnight or until firm. 4. Using foil, remove fudge from pan; carefully peel off foil. Cut into 1-in. squares. Store in the refrigerator. Yield: 2-3/4 pounds. |
